PostSubject: sirio antenna   Sirio - sirio antenna Icon_minitimeSat Oct 22, 2022 8:46 pm

Hi has anyone had any experience of the sirio starduster m400 just been looking at one and it looks fairly solid if thoughts are positive i might get one, thanks-i have since my last post looked at the height of one and they are over sixteen feet plus a pole so it looks like im going back to just a silver rod that i can hide in a tree  Rolling Eyes

PostSubject: Re: sirio antenna   Sirio - sirio antenna Icon_minitimeSun Oct 23, 2022 1:34 pm

They might be 16ft long but they mount in the middle so only 8ft above the pole. They are basically a dipole so no real gain but they have a good bandwidth. They look the same as my old Skylab aerial I had in the 80's. There's nothing wrong with them but they're not outstanding. Your silver rod may perform better but being hidden in a tree won't help it, and I bet it's longer than 16ft too.
